I wanted to buy these sandals but I'm not quite sure how I could wear them.

I dress fairly modestly and I only wear full length dress, skirts, and jeans/pants. I also don't really wear skinny jeans, but boyfriend, flared, and trouser jeans are cool.

Can I still rock these sandals without looking like I'm trying too hard?

Those fabulous teal sandals do not only look with skinny jeans, but will also look great with baggy ankle length boyfriend jeans, long skirts and gorgeous maxi dresses!

Other options beside the skinny jeans are: straight leg jeans (a little fitted around the legs but slightly flared to avoid 'choking' your ankles), flare and wide leg jeans. I'm not a complete fan of bootcut jeans (I prefer my pants to either be fitted around my calves or completely flared but that's just a matter of personal taste) but they would work with the sandals.

Here are some outfit ideas with the sandals


How to wear trendy sandals, Seychelles sandals


Look #1
Here I chose a black v-neck maxi dress (add a black lace camisole underneath it to avoid showing off too much cleavage), a stack of beaded bracelets and a cropped denim jacket.

You can also switch to a cardigan but make sure that it's on the shorter side because long cardigan sweater together with a maxi dress can swamp you up. It looks too much if you're petite or very skinny.

Another tip is to go for a longer sleeved maxi dress if you prefer to cover up your arms without having to wear the jacket. Short and long sleeved are both stylish.

Look #2
A very casual yet chic outfit consisting of a slightly fitted long skirt with A-line hem, simple white v-neck t-shirt, a trendy turquoise/gold multi-layer necklace.

Adding a statement jewelry is a great way to spruce up a plain outfit - adding some chic glam to it!

Look #3
This a cute and casual outfit consisting of relaxed boyfriend jeans and a coral-pink 3/4 sleeve blouse tee.

You can wear the Seychelles sandals with another bright color as long as it is solid colored or consists of a simple color scheme. In this way, the rest of the clothes won't compete with the sandals.

I also added a stack of bangle bracelets to give a more trendy take to the whole ensemble.

Look #4
Here I added straight leg jeans with a tunic shirt and a fashionable brown dome studded belt around the waist. I added the belt to give more shape to the loose tunic shirt, but of course you can leave it out and go casual all the way.

If you're not comfortable with straight leg jeans then you could opt for flare or wide leg, but I recommend that you swap up the shirt with something more fitted or at least keep the belt on to maintain a nipped silhouette.
